Mellow and mild a soft wind hisses,
Beckoning me back to white wine kisses,
Purple ribbons round white fences twisted,
Peppermint moons and marshmallow fishes.
An angel's call prompts me thither,
To blue green waters and rushing rivers,
To soft sweet sobs and hot pink faces,
Outstretched arms and warm embraces.
The silky slide of palms o'er tender skin,
Of cobblestone streets and apricot gin,
Headfirst into deepest blue seas,
Letting go of fear and skinning knees.
Your gentle touch makes it all real,
My heart does beat my soul does feel,
My breath draws in all that was scattered,
That I now taste love is all that matters.
Beauty and grace, blend in motion,
Life and breath and heartfelt devotion,
Linger with me lest I forget thee,
Sweet remembrance thy true melody.
